On Tue, 23 Dec 1997, Jennings, James wrote:

> I was afraid of this.  What perplexes me just a bit is the
> Hardware-HOWTO specifically states this is supported.  Ah but is the
> wrong side of glory to be expecting perfection isn't it.  If I was able
> to move up too, will my regular Quantum SCSI drive with its 50 pin
> connector work with the 2940?
> 
> Ouch!! This smarts.
> 
> Jim J.
Shouldn't be a problem.  The 2940U only has a 50 pin connector; the 2940UW
(more expensive!) sports 68 and 50 pin connectors.  Do you want me to dig
out the changes I put in the fdomain driver?  It may work for you; I use
it for tape, because IDE and UltraIDE disks are so cheap at the moment.
